Publisher Description: Siblings Devin and Briana O'Toole are facing the biggest adventure of their lives. In exchange for Bree's freedom, they have agreed to make on voyage on the new Viking ship Conquest. With explorer Leif Erikson they travel from Norway to Iceland, then to Greenland and beyond, encountering the dangers of the northern waters and an unknown enemy within the ship's crew. Will the hardships be worth it in the end, or will Bree remain a slave? Mikkel, the young captain of the Conquest, is full of ambition. More than anything, he has always wanted wealth and fame. But he will need courage to lead his men on such a perilous journey--and to regain his lost honor. He doesn't even want to think about letting Bree go free. Only God can give Mikkel, Bree, and Devin a heart of courage for the challenges that lie ahead. |
